In the United States, an execution chamber will usually contain a table. In most cases, a room is located adjacent to an execution chamber, where witnesses may watch the execution through glass windows. All except for one of the states which allow are equipped with a death chamber, but many states rarely put them to use. The sole exception is, which has not had an inmate on death row since the 1940s. (August 2010) () In the United Kingdom, the execution chamber was part of a larger complex, often referred to as the 'Execution Suite'. The room, usually formed from two single, contained the large, usually double-leaved, but in some older chambers such as at Oxford, single-leaved, and operating lever. The wooden beam from which the rope was suspended was usually set into the walls of the chamber above, with the floor removed. At Wandsworth Prison the floor was retained and holes allowed the rope and chains through. Oxford's chamber was of an old 19th-century type, and the beam was set into the walls of the chamber just above head height. Such rooms were almost always built into one of the wings of a; following the recommendation of prison governors during the 1948 Royal Commission on, further execution chambers were housed in purpose-built blocks, separate from the main prison. The last to be constructed in Britain, at, was built in 1962, and was used one year later for the hanging of, the last person to be executed in Scotland. The last officially operational gallows in the United Kingdom (as several remained unofficially in other prisons), at, was removed in 1994.
